Output dff3494d9fa0c0f6037c6007c985bf8e61ea094e53f979baf2f2e4ce892288b7:2

value
26268979
script pubkey
OP_0 OP_PUSHBYTES_20 18aac69bea3e7e39e4cc82b6b6f7c132b8d2da9f
address
ltc1qrz4vdxl28elrnexvs2mtda7px2ud9k5lj2drd2
transaction
dff3494d9fa0c0f6037c6007c985bf8e61ea094e53f979baf2f2e4ce892288b7
spent
true